The Telangana Rashtra Samithi oin Wednesday demanded that the Centre formulate a new national policy on utilisation of natural gas.
Addressing a press conference at Telangana Bhavan, Sircilla MLA K Taraka Ramarao said that the Centre should give priority in the allocation of gas to the State where it was being produced. He demanded that the Empowered Group of Ministers revive its decision on supply of KG Basin gas to different States. Regarding the Centre’s decision to stop supply of gas to Ratnagiri power plant, he said the cancellation was temporary and the Centre should take a permanent decision on the issue.
The TRS leader also criticised the State Government for not supplying gas to the power plants being run by AP Power Generation Corporation or GENCO. Instead of supplying gas to Shankarpally and Nedunuru projects, the government has been supplying gas to the Lanco and GMR power plants. Demanding that the State Government divert the gas supplies to Genco plants, he also asked it furnish the reasons that led it supply gas to private plant while ignoring public-sector plants.
